‘Quake in Aleutian islands’:

-

A 6.2 magnitude quake rattled the remote, sparsely populated Andreanof islands in Alaska’s Aleutian island chain on Monday, the US Geological Survey said.

The earthquake was recorded at 1603 GMT, 57 miles (93 kilometers) north of Atka, Alaska.

Less than 500 people live in the Andreanofs, the vast majority of them in the town of Adak on Adak Island.

The Andreanofs are near the end of the Aleutian chain, which extends westward into the Bering Sea from southern Alaska. (AFP)
